1. Clean Up Storage The Smart Way, Not The Hard Way
The first thing many people do when their phone feels slow is delete random photos, videos, or apps. This helps a little, but it is not enough. Modern Android devices include storage tools that can safely remove old junk files, temporary data, and unused apps without you having to guess what is important.
How to use the built-in storage cleaner
- Open the Settings app.
- Tap Storage or Device care (name depends on your phone brand).
- Look for a button like Clean up, Smart Storage, or Optimize.
- Review the suggestions and confirm the clean-up.
Focus on removing large temporary files, old downloads, and apps you have not opened in months. This single step can free several gigabytes of space, reduce lag, and make app switching feel smoother.
2. Turn On Adaptive Battery For All-Day Power
Battery complaints are one of the most common Android issues. Yet most people never enable the feature that is designed to fix exactly that: Adaptive Battery. In 2025, this system is clever enough to learn when you use certain apps, when you usually charge, and which apps do not deserve to run all day in the background.
How to enable Adaptive Battery
- Go to Settings.
- Tap Battery or Battery & performance.
- Look for Adaptive Battery or Smart Battery.
- Turn it on and keep it on.
Give it a few days to learn your habits. You should see fewer overnight battery drops, less background drain, and more screen time before the next charge. It is one of the most effective Android tips for 2025 because it quietly works in the background with no extra effort from you.
3. Use Play Protect To Block Scam Apps Early
App-based scams are getting smarter. Some malicious apps look professional, have polished icons, and even fake positive reviews. Google’s Play Protect is built to watch for this problem. It scans apps from the Play Store and regularly checks installed apps for harmful behavior.
How to check Play Protect status
- Open the Google Play Store.
- Tap your profile icon in the top-right corner.
- Select Play Protect.
- Make sure scanning is turned on.
- Tap Scan if you want an immediate manual check.
If Play Protect warns you about an app, take it seriously and uninstall that app. It is not perfect, but it adds an extra layer of automatic protection. For more details, you can read the official documentation on the Google Play Protect help page.
4. Audit Your Privacy Dashboard Every Week
Privacy is not just a buzzword anymore – it is a daily concern. The Privacy Dashboard in Android shows which apps accessed sensitive permissions like camera, microphone, and location, and when they did it. This gives you a clear picture of how your data is being used.
How to use the Privacy Dashboard
- Open Settings.
- Tap Privacy.
- Select Privacy Dashboard.
- Check the list of apps that used your camera, mic, and location recently.
- Tap on any app and adjust or remove its permission if it feels unnecessary.
A quick weekly check is enough. You might be surprised how often some apps try to use your location or microphone in the background. Tightening these permissions is one of the easiest ways to protect your privacy without changing how you use your phone.
5. Use Game Mode As A Performance Booster
Many phones now have a Game Mode or Performance Mode. It is usually marketed to gamers, but it is actually useful for anyone who runs demanding apps. When activated, it reduces background processes, limits notifications, and focuses the phone’s resources on the app you are using.
How to take advantage of Game Mode
- Swipe down from the top to open the quick settings panel.
- Look for Game Mode, Performance Mode, or a similar tile.
- Turn it on before playing games or running heavy apps like video editors.
- Turn it off when you are done to return to normal power saving behavior.
This simple switch can reduce stutter, cut down loading times, and make your device feel much more responsive when it matters. It is an especially valuable tip for mid-range phones from a few years ago.
6. Let Live Translate Help You In Real-Time
One of the most impressive Android features in 2025 is Live Translate. It can translate text, voice, and sometimes even on-screen content in real time. If you live in a multicultural area, travel, or simply chat with people who speak other languages, this feature can be a daily lifesaver.
Where to find Live Translate
- Open Settings.
- Tap System or Languages & input (exact name may differ).
- Look for Live Translate or Live Caption & Translate.
- Turn it on and choose your preferred languages.
Once set up, you can use it inside messaging apps, voice calls, and supported media. It is a powerful, practical example of how Android AI can help you communicate more easily and confidently.
7. Turn On AI Scene Optimization For Better Photos
Smartphone cameras in 2025 are not just capturing light – they are analyzing the scene in front of you. AI scene optimization detects faces, food, text, landscapes, night scenes, and more. Then it adjusts color, contrast, and sharpness for a better-looking picture.
How to enable scene optimization
- Open your Camera app.
- Tap the Settings icon inside the camera view.
- Look for options like Scene optimizer, AI camera, or Smart HDR.
- Turn them on.
For best results, clean your camera lens with a soft cloth and allow the phone a second to focus before you tap the shutter. Combined with AI scene optimization, this can make even a mid-range device produce surprisingly sharp and vibrant photos.
8. Use Clipboard Manager For Faster Work And Study
If you copy and paste a lot – notes, links, quotes, messages – then the built-in Clipboard Manager is your quiet productivity partner. Instead of only remembering the last thing you copied, it can store multiple recent items for you to reuse.
How to use Clipboard Manager
- Copy some text as usual.
- Go to any text field (like a note, message, or browser).
- Tap and hold in the text field until the menu appears.
- Look for Clipboard and tap it.
You will see a list of things you copied recently. This makes it much easier to paste repeated information, collect bits of research, or move content between apps without going back and forth.
9. Switch To Quick Share For Quality File Transfers
Sending photos and videos through normal chat apps often compresses them, which is why they look blurry or low-quality. Features like Quick Share (or Nearby Share on some devices) let you send files directly between phones and other devices without destroying the quality and without using your mobile data.
How to use Quick Share or Nearby Share
- Open the photo, video, or file you want to send.
- Tap the Share button.
- Select Quick Share or Nearby Share.
- Choose the nearby device you want to send it to.
Make sure Bluetooth and location are turned on for both devices. Once you use this method a few times, it quickly becomes your favorite way to send large files without losing detail.
10. Keep Android Updated – It Is Your Silent Protection
System updates are not just about new icons or visual changes. They often contain critical security patches, bug fixes, performance improvements, and camera upgrades. Skipping updates leaves your phone vulnerable and can cause strange issues like random crashes or overheating.
How to check for Android updates
- Go to Settings.
- Scroll down and tap System or About phone.
- Select System update or Software update.
- Tap Check for updates and follow the instructions.
Ideally, install updates when your phone is connected to Wi-Fi and has enough battery or is plugged in to charge. Regular updates keep your device safer, faster, and more compatible with new apps.
Bonus: Simple Maintenance Habits That Keep Your Phone Fast
Beyond these ten essential Android tips for 2025, a few simple habits can keep your device feeling fresh:
- Restart once a week – this clears temporary glitches and resets background processes.
- Uninstall apps you do not use – if you have not opened an app in a month, remove it.
- Clean your home screen – too many widgets and live wallpapers can slow things down.
- Review notifications – turn off alerts from apps you do not care about to reduce distraction and battery drain.
None of these steps takes long on its own, but together they create a smoother, more relaxed experience. Your phone feels less cluttered, and you feel more in control.
